Location
Lampeter Velfrey lies in the east Pembrokeshire countryside within an area of highly regarded early, productive land, suitable for grazing, cropping or arable purposes, being inherently fertile.
The village has a strong sense of community and within the village lies the 13th century Grade II listed church of St Peter. Lampeter Velfrey lies within easy reach of the A40 which links to the M4, and is some 3 miles or so from the small towns of Narberth and Whitland. Between them they offer a good range of local services and facilities that cater for most everyday requirements including doctors’ surgeries, primary schools. In addition, there is a comprehensive school in Whitland and a train station in both towns, etc. Further afield lie the market towns of Haverfordwest and Carmarthen which provide a greater range of amenities including supermarkets, shopping centres, hospitals etc. Also within easy reach is the superb scenery of the renowned Pembrokeshire coastline being approximately 6 miles to the nearest beach.
